Dawn (Al-Fajr)
In the name of God, The Most Gracious, The Dispenser of Grace
By the dawn 1 By the Nights twice five; 2 By the even and odd (contrasted); 3 And the night when it departeth, 4 Considering all this - could there be, to anyone endowed with reason, a [more] solemn evidence of the truth? 5 (Muhammad), consider how your Lord dealt with the tribe of Ad, 6 (And) the tall giants of Iram? 7 The like of which were not created in the (other) cities; 8 And with Thamud who hewed out rocks in the vale, 9 And with Pharaoh, firm of might, 10 Who did transgress beyond bounds in the lands (in the disobedience of Allah). 11 and exceeded in corruption therein. 12 Thy Lord unloosed on them a scourge of chastisement; 13 Most surely your Lord is watching. 14 As for man, whenever his Lord tries him, and honours him, and blesses him, then he says, 'My Lord has honoured me.' 15 But when He tries him and restricts his provision, he says, "My Lord has humiliated me." 16 No indeed; but you honour not the orphan, 17 And urge not on the feeding of the poor. 18 And you readily devour the inheritance with greed. 19 And ye love wealth with inordinate love! 20 No indeed! When the earth is crushed and ground to dust, 21 And your Lord has come and the angels, rank upon rank, 22 And Hell is brought near, that day will man remember, but of what avail will then remembering be? 23 He will say, “Alas – if only I had sent some good deeds ahead, during my lifetime!” 24 So on that Day, none will punish [as severely] as His punishment, 25 and none can bind with bonds like His! 26 'O soul at peace, 27 return unto thy Lord, well-pleased, well-pleasing! 28 Join My worshipers and 29 yea, enter thou My paradise!" 30
